A sound roof and a stable foundation are the pillars of any structure. Yet, these crucial elements often hide subtle problems that can deteriorate over time, leading to costly repairs and safety hazards. A comprehensive inspection by a qualified professional is essential to expose these hidden issues before they become major concerns.

During a roof inspection, experts will diligently examine the shingles, flashing, gutters, and ventilation system for signs of damage, wear, or leaks. They'll also inspect the attic space for moisture, insulation adequacy, and potential pest infestations.

A foundation inspection involves scrutinizing the structure's framework for cracks, settling, or other structural problems. This includes inspecting the walls, basement, crawlspace, and any visible plumbing or drainage systems.

By pinpointing these potential problems early on, you can take preemptive steps to prevent further damage and protect your investment.

Safeguard Your Investment: Essential Roof & Foundation Maintenance Checks

Your home is a significant investment, and maintaining its structural integrity is a crucial role in protecting that value. Regularly inspecting and caring for your roof and foundation can prevent costly repairs down the road.

Initiate by visually examining your roof Foundation Inspections for any missing, damaged, or curled shingles. Check for cracks or leaks in flashing around chimneys and vents. Give close attention to gutters and downspouts, ensuring they are clear of debris and functioning properly to redirect rainwater away from your foundation.

Next, turn your focus to the foundation. Look for cracks, gaps, or settling in walls and floors. Check the ground around your home for signs of erosion or water pooling. These indicators can suggest underlying problems that require immediate attention.

By performing these simple maintenance checks on a periodic basis, you can help prevent major issues from developing. A little preventative care goes a long way in safeguarding your investment and ensuring the long-term health of your home.
